Ulgoth's Beard quests
Been a long time since I played this the first time, so I need some advice. Do you have to find someone in BG city to tell you to go to UB? Or can you just go there and start doing the quests?

You just go to Ulgoth's Beard and people give you quests from there. Outside of your question as a side note, there is something you can do in BG city to make an interaction different in Ulgoth's Beard, but it's very minor and more of a hindrance

In order to do the Balduran's Final Voyage quest, you must speak with Mendas in a small house to the far West on the Ulgoth's Beard map. You will be approached by an NPC and told that someone wants to meet with you. He will ask you to retrieve the Sea Charts from the Merchant League Counting House in Baldur's Gate.

Return to Baldur's Gate North of the Thieves Guild exit the map due North. The first building on your right is the Merchant League Counting House, not to be confused with the Merchant League building that is part of Scar's quest. Pick the lock and enter. You will be challenged by a guard, answer "My business is my own" any other answer provokes a fight and every kill results in a massive Rep hit. Go upstairs and speak with the Captain, who I think initiates the conversation. Answer him "Do you need anything else for your voyage" whereby he will ask you to go to the Blushing Mermaid to get some DeTrainor's ale for him. It will cost you some gold to obtain. Return and when you give it to him, he will ask you to hold his Sea Charts...take them and get out.

When you are ready to go on the voyage, return to Mendas and give him the charts. You will want to make sure you are stocked up on Magic Arrows/Bolts/Bullets and you may want to have the Bastard Sword Kondar +1/+3 vs. Shape Shifters (even if you don't have anyone proficient) which you either obtained in the Cloakwood or by completing the Seven Suns quest in BG. You may also want to have The Burning Earth, Longsword Flametongue. These are two of the I think four weapons that can hit a specific monster you will encounter.

Be well stocked with Potions, Scrolls and anything else you may need including the lowly Magic Missile spell. Hard Save before you depart as you may decide you aren't ready for this area once you get there. It is totally optional content and there's no "big prize" other than additional XP and some loot.
